Day 1

Upon arrival at danang international airport, i took a Shuttle bus to Hoi an(this is the cheapest form of transport i can find to hoi an other than the troublesome bus)

After arriving at Hoi an, i checked into my hotel(Ivy hotel hoi an) and dropped my bags 1st, location wise is fantastic..it is just next to the ancient town and a stone away from the night market but some of it's appliances doesn't work and breakfast is just meh due to the number of people staying there

After dropping my bags, i walked to the nearest booth to purchased my entrance ticket for the ancient town
there are actually many entrance to the ancient town that is unguarded but you wouldn't want to be caught without a ticket when they requested for 1 when they doing spotcheck
the ticket is 120k VND and includes 4 ticket that enables you to enter any 4 of the many halls, temples and museum in hoi an..maps is provided to you alongside with the ticket
This is my view at the ticket booth(1 of the entrance/exit of ancient town)
user posted image

After having my ticket, i walked to 09 Shoe Shop to custom made my working shoe, you can custom made many things that is leather in hoi an. From shoes, to jacket to hats to wallet and bags, they also custom made shirt, pants, suits, dresses.
I paid 1.7Mil VND for my shoes, it cost almost the same as shoes sold in branded shop but this is custom made to fit your feet and made using good quality leather, overall it's worth it

After having my feet measured, i walked to madam khanh to eat their banh mi for late lunch..it is said to be the 1 out of 2 most delicious banh mi in hoi an

Day 3

Today we've booked a private car to take us from Hoi an to Hue
https://www.transfertohoian.com/tour/transp...ue-private-car/

First stop will be marble mountain which is like 15-20 minutes from Hoi an town only
The entrance ticket for marble mountain is 40k VND/person
There is an option an elevator for 15k VND/person but i don't think it's worth it
I always saw blogs mentioning there is an elevator that takes you to the top
Apparently it only eliminates the 1st fleet of stairs from your journey only so it's totally not worth it at all

This is the only stairs that you eliminate using the elevator
user posted image

Upon reaching up by stair, this will greet you first
user posted image

user posted image

If you chose to go up using elevator, you'll be greeted by this first
user posted image

These are all the attraction at the same level and you'll be able to enjoy it by walking around
After that, we'll have to climb more steps going up
user posted image

After passing that hole, you'll reach a place where you can do some rock climbing should you want to
At the place of where they're doing rock climbing, turn left...there is an entrance to a cave
THIS cave entrance is actually a gateway to the top of marble mountain and it's not an easy climb should you want to proceed
it's tight and tricky inside and apparently not a lot of people chose to do it and just keep walking straight
Should you chose to do it, once you've entered the cave, you'll be greeted by this
user posted image

just keep going forward and eventually you will reach the top
user posted image

The view on top should be quite spectacular if the weather is good but unfortunately it was raining when i was there
and that adds up the difficulty to reach the top more
Once you reach the top, there is another way down on the other side
NEVER EVER go down the way you went up because it's too dangerous, you could get hurt based on the position of those rocks

After u reach bottom, it's actually the same place where you entered the cave if you walk back abit
Continue forward and you'll enter a another cave
This cave basically has a temple in it and the lighting is thumbup.gif
user posted image

This will greet you at the end of the cave
user posted image

user posted image

The whole marble mountain can be finish in about 2 hours

Next stop will be cham museum which is in danang
Entrance ticket is 60k VND/person
It's basically a museum full of ancient scupture
user posted image

user posted image

user posted image

After cham museum comes the main highlight of the day which is hai van pass itself
It's a must do trip when in danang/hoi an when going to hue
my advice is do not go by bus because they will just use the hai van tunnel which has nothing to see

After reaching hue, i decided to drop off my bags at my hotel 1st, i stayed at poetic hue which is walking distance to the truoung tien bridge
After dropping my bags, i went to the nearby huetourist office to buy my bus ticket for the next day because that is the only company that has bus that will go danang at 4PM
The train and other buses will leave really early(before noon) or too late at 7PM which doesn't suit my plan because i have a tour early morning next day that will end at 2PM and i don't want to waste another day staying at hue
The bus ticket are 150k VND/each
Upon purchasing my ticket, i walked to truoeng tien bridge
This is the bridge that connects the south and north island of hue
North side consist of market and the imperial city
South side is where all the restaurant, supermarkets and hotels are

After my meal in hanh restaurant, we headed to Che Hem for dessert to wash it down
This place is super local because there is absolutely no tourist here and there is no english menu
If you ask for an english menu, there is however someone that will vaguely tell you what do they have
price is 10k VND flat for every che they have
user posted image

user posted image

The way they serve it here is different because they separate the che and the ice, you have to add it yourself
whereas other places will come mixed for you
user posted image

After finishing our dessert, we walk back to the bridge area because i've been told there is a night market there
But end up i regretted it and don't recommend people doing so because the night market is super short, it's practically a few stalls that you can finish in 5 minutes
You're better off going somewhere else like the big C
